Grand Rapids, a city located in the state of Michigan (MI), is home to a population of approximately 609,023 people. Grand Rapids boasts a median age of 31.8, with around 17.5% of its residents aged 60 or above. 4.3% of the population identifies as US Veterans. 11.6% of Grand Rapids residents are disabled. The city has an average household income of $61,634, while the unemployment rate stands at 5.6%, and around 19% of the population is considered to be living below the poverty level. In terms of housing, the average home value in Grand Rapids is $203,303, with a monthly rent averaging $1138.
About Adult Day Care
Adult day care offers older adults and those with disabilities professional care, socialization, and enrichment opportunities in community-based group settings. Programs are designed to provide supervised care and promote quality of life for both participants and their families. The 3 main types of adult day care are social adult day care, adult day health care (ADHC), and specialized adult day care.
